* weather.py(correlate): Previously the airports, places, stations,
zctas and zones files lacked trailing newlines, so this trivial patch
adds them before each is closed for writing.
for key, value in sorted( airports[airport].items() ):
airports_fd.write( "\n%s = %s" % (key, value) )
count += 1
for key, value in sorted( airports[airport].items() ):
airports_fd.write( "\n%s = %s" % (key, value) )
count += 1
+ airports_fd.write("\n")
airports_fd.close()
print("done (%s sections)." % count)
message = "Writing %s..." % places_fn
airports_fd.close()
print("done (%s sections)." % count)
message = "Writing %s..." % places_fn
for key, value in sorted( places[fips].items() ):
places_fd.write( "\n%s = %s" % (key, value) )
count += 1
for key, value in sorted( places[fips].items() ):
places_fd.write( "\n%s = %s" % (key, value) )
count += 1
places_fd.close()
print("done (%s sections)." % count)
message = "Writing %s..." % stations_fn
places_fd.close()
print("done (%s sections)." % count)
message = "Writing %s..." % stations_fn
for key, value in sorted( stations[station].items() ):
stations_fd.write( "\n%s = %s" % (key, value) )
count += 1
for key, value in sorted( stations[station].items() ):
stations_fd.write( "\n%s = %s" % (key, value) )
count += 1
+ stations_fd.write("\n")
stations_fd.close()
print("done (%s sections)." % count)
message = "Writing %s..." % zctas_fn
stations_fd.close()
print("done (%s sections)." % count)
message = "Writing %s..." % zctas_fn
for key, value in sorted( zctas[zcta].items() ):
zctas_fd.write( "\n%s = %s" % (key, value) )
count += 1
for key, value in sorted( zctas[zcta].items() ):
zctas_fd.write( "\n%s = %s" % (key, value) )
count += 1
zctas_fd.close()
print("done (%s sections)." % count)
message = "Writing %s..." % zones_fn
zctas_fd.close()
print("done (%s sections)." % count)
message = "Writing %s..." % zones_fn
for key, value in sorted( zones[zone].items() ):
zones_fd.write( "\n%s = %s" % (key, value) )
count += 1
for key, value in sorted( zones[zone].items() ):
zones_fd.write( "\n%s = %s" % (key, value) )
count += 1
zones_fd.close()
print("done (%s sections)." % count)
message = "Starting QA check..."
zones_fd.close()
print("done (%s sections)." % count)
message = "Starting QA check..."